The main difference between a Junior Software Development Engineer and a Software Developer lies in experience level and responsibilities. Junior Software Development Engineers are typically entry-level, working under supervision on basic tasks, while Software Developers may have more experience and handle more complex projects independently.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and are common in tech industries, but the Junior role emphasizes learning and growth.

What does a junior software development engineer do?

A Junior Software Development Engineer is an entry-level professional who assists in designing, developing, testing, and maintaining software applications. They typically work under the guidance of senior engineers, contributing to coding tasks, debugging, and documentation. Their responsibilities may also include collaborating with other team members to solve technical problems and learn best practices in software engineering. This role is ideal for recent graduates or those with limited experience who are looking to build their skills and advance in the software development field.

What are some common challenges faced by junior software development engineers during their first year on the job?

Junior Software Development Engineers often encounter challenges such as adapting to a new codebase, understanding team workflows, and learning best practices for writing clean, maintainable code. They may also find it challenging to accurately estimate task complexity and communicate progress with senior team members. However, most teams provide mentorship and code reviews to help juniors grow, and active collaboration is encouraged to facilitate learning and integration into the team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a junior software development engineer?

To thrive as a Junior Software Development Engineer, a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, algorithms, and data structures is essential,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with languages like Java, Python, or JavaScript, as well as experience using version control systems such as Git, is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, eagerness to learn, and effective teamwork and communication skills help individuals excel in collaborative and dynamic environments.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ering quality code, adapting to new technologies, and contributing meaningfully to software development projects.

Seeking a Junior Software Engineer to join our team in support of the JTAPS program in Huntsville, AL.
The Joint Targeting and Precision Solutions (JTAPS) is a government owned, managed, and developed suite of software. JTAPS is used by the Joint Services, and numerous labs in support of continued development and testing of systems employed for defense of the United States and our Allies. The JTAPS team has in-depth experience in Command and Control, Fires, Maneuvers, Tactical Data Links (TDL), Test, Enterprise Information Technology, Software, Systems Engineering, and Information Assurance.
